The Alpha-1 Antitrypsin Deficiency Augmentation Therapy Market is valued at USD 2.1 billion in 2025 and is projected to grow at a CAGR of 8.3% to reach USD 4.3 billion by 2034.The Alpha-1 Antitrypsin Deficiency Augmentation Therapy Market is a specialized sector within the rare disease therapeutics industry, focusing on the development and provision of treatments for alpha-1 antitrypsin deficiency (AATD), a genetic disorder that can lead to lung and liver disease. This market encompasses a range of augmentation therapies, including plasma-derived and recombinant alpha-1 antitrypsin, each tailored to specific patient needs and disease severity.
